Based on sociological standards, the behaviors by the correctional officers in the Stanford prison experiment coincided with expected <u>Social roles</u>; the guards gave orders and expected the prisoners to follow them.

This is because <u>Social roles</u> is a term in socio-psychology that is used to describe the role people act as units of a social group.

Social roles State that individuals' roles or behaviors change to fit what is expected of others in that role category.

The principle of <u>Social role</u> was experimented in the Stanford prison experiment (SPE) at Stanford University in 1971.

Hence, in this case, it is concluded that the correct answer is "<u>Social role</u>."
